DeepSeek冲击:AI模型本地化部署的变革与实践
2025.09.25 20:04浏览量:0简介:本文探讨DeepSeek模型对AI行业的冲击,分析其技术优势与本地化部署的必要性,提供从环境配置到优化的全流程实践指南,助力企业低成本实现AI赋能。
一、DeepSeek冲击:AI技术普惠化的新拐点
近年来,AI大模型的参数规模与算力需求呈指数级增长,OpenAI的GPT系列、Meta的LLaMA等模型虽展现出强大能力,但其高昂的训练与推理成本将中小企业拒之门外。在此背景下,DeepSeek的崛起标志着AI技术从“贵族化”向“普惠化”的转型。其核心优势在于:
轻量化架构设计
DeepSeek通过模型压缩(如知识蒸馏、量化剪枝)与动态计算路径优化,在保持性能的同时将参数量降低至传统模型的1/3。例如,其6B参数版本在文本生成任务中接近GPT-3.5的准确率,但推理速度提升2倍以上。开源生态的深度整合
与闭源模型不同,DeepSeek提供完整的代码库与预训练权重,支持企业基于自身数据微调。这种开放性降低了技术门槛,使医疗、金融等垂直领域能快速构建定制化AI应用。隐私与合规的双重保障
在数据安全法规日益严格的今天,DeepSeek的本地化部署能力成为关键卖点。企业无需将敏感数据上传至第三方云平台,即可完成模型训练与推理,满足GDPR、网络安全法等要求。
二、本地化部署的必要性:从成本到战略的考量
1. 成本效益的颠覆性重构
传统云服务模式下,企业需支付API调用费、流量费及可能的定制开发费用。以某电商平台的客服系统为例,使用闭源模型每月成本超10万元,而基于DeepSeek的本地化部署将硬件投入(如4块NVIDIA A100 GPU)分摊后,单次查询成本降低80%。
2. 业务连续性的保障
依赖第三方API存在服务中断风险。2023年某云服务商因算力短缺导致API响应延迟超10秒,直接造成合作企业日均10万元的交易损失。本地化部署可完全规避此类风险。
3. 定制化能力的质变
某制造业企业通过在DeepSeek中嵌入行业知识图谱,将设备故障预测准确率从72%提升至89%。这种深度定制是通用模型难以实现的。
三、本地化部署实践:从环境搭建到性能调优
1. 硬件环境配置指南
- 推荐配置:
- 训练阶段:8块A100 80GB GPU(FP16精度下可支持175B参数模型)
- 推理阶段:单块A100或消费级RTX 4090(INT8量化后6B模型)
- 成本优化方案:
使用NVIDIA Triton推理服务器进行多模型并发,GPU利用率提升40%;
通过TensorRT-LLM将模型转换为优化引擎,推理延迟降低35%。
2. 软件栈部署流程
依赖安装:
# 以Ubuntu 22.04为例sudo apt install python3.10-dev cuda-12.2pip install torch==2.0.1 transformers==4.30.0 deepseek-model
模型加载与微调:
from transformers import AutoModelForCausalLM, AutoTokenizermodel = AutoModelForCausalLM.from_pretrained("deepseek/6b", device_map="auto")tokenizer = AutoTokenizer.from_pretrained("deepseek/6b")# 领域数据微调示例from trl import SFTTrainertrainer = SFTTrainer(model,train_dataset=custom_dataset,args={"per_device_train_batch_size": 4})trainer.train()
服务化部署:
使用FastAPI构建RESTful API:from fastapi import FastAPIapp = FastAPI()@app.post("/generate")async def generate(prompt: str):inputs = tokenizer(prompt, return_tensors="pt").to("cuda")outputs = model.generate(**inputs, max_length=200)return {"response": tokenizer.decode(outputs[0])}
3. 性能优化实战技巧
量化压缩:
使用bitsandbytes库进行4-bit量化,模型体积缩小75%且精度损失<2%:from bitsandbytes.optim import GlobalOptimManagermodel = model.to("cuda")GlobalOptimManager.get_instance().register_optimizer_override(model, "bitsandbytes_optim4bit")
动态批处理:
通过Triton的dynamic_batching配置,将小请求合并处理,吞吐量提升3倍。
四、挑战与应对策略
1. 硬件兼容性问题
某金融企业部署时发现A100与旧版CUDA驱动冲突,解决方案为:
- 升级驱动至525.85.12版本
- 使用
nvidia-smi topo -m检查NVLink连接状态 - 在Slurm调度系统中添加GPU亲和性约束
2. 模型更新与维护
建立CI/CD流水线,通过Docker镜像实现版本快速迭代:
FROM nvidia/cuda:12.2.0-baseCOPY requirements.txt .RUN pip install -r requirements.txtCOPY ./model /app/modelCMD ["python", "/app/serve.py"]
3. 伦理与安全风险
实施输出过滤机制,结合正则表达式与敏感词库:
import redef filter_output(text):patterns = [r"(密码|账号)\s*[:=]\s*\w+", r"1[3-9]\d{9}"]for p in patterns:if re.search(p, text):return "输出包含敏感信息"return text
五、未来展望:本地化与云原生的融合
DeepSeek的冲击正在重塑AI部署范式。一方面,边缘计算设备(如Jetson AGX Orin)的算力提升使本地化部署向更小场景渗透;另一方面,混合云架构允许企业将核心模型保留在本地,同时利用云平台进行分布式训练。Gartner预测,到2026年,40%的企业将采用“本地推理+云端微调”的混合模式。
对于开发者而言,掌握DeepSeek的本地化部署不仅是技术能力的体现,更是参与AI平权运动的重要方式。通过降低技术门槛,我们正见证一个“人人可训模、处处用AI”的新时代的到来。

发表评论
登录后可评论,请前往 登录 或 注册